Transaction 515ed74304d372e3ed3e54667c40000b6528c01a0905815dfe0cbfeaf9814968

20 Input
2 Outputs
  • 515ed74304d372e3ed3e54667c40000b6528c01a0905815dfe0cbfeaf9814968:0
  • value  1000000
    address  1Q9w6T4JCYMqxUvzwmt6srJV8RTiF54vDe
  • 515ed74304d372e3ed3e54667c40000b6528c01a0905815dfe0cbfeaf9814968:1
  • value  50000000
    address  12fZ2LPt79bkRJu7h3n7rzuDqus6iJ6jWV